Women's Basketball Drops First Road Contest Of 2017-18 Season At Jefferson University
Rams Top The Purple Knights, 64-53
Philadelphia, Pa.-The University of Bridgeport women's basketball team traveled to Philadelphia, Pa. for its first road game of the road game of the 2017-18 season, and the Purple Knights fell to the host Jefferson University Rams, 64-53, on Wednesday evening. With the loss, UB is now 1-2 overall, and the victory keeps the host Rams undefeated at 3-0 in the early going of the season.
Junior center Samnell Vonleh (Swampscott, Mass.) led the Purple Knights notching a double-double with 15 points and a game-best 13 rebounds. Vonleh also blocked five shots on the night. Senior Morgen Caution (Baltimore, Md.) also reached double-digit scoring with 11 points and fell just shy of her own double-double grabbing nine boards.
The Purple Knights struggled with their long-range shooting on Wednesday night hitting only 2-of-18 three-point shots, and UB also had a tough time from the foul line connecting on only 5-of-13 free threes. Bridgeport committed 21 turnovers in the loss that led to a total of 27 points for the Rams.
